## Changelog — PortionPal v2.4.1

Hey, welcome aboard! Quick note on this release of PortionPal, our recipe-scaling calculator. We rotated the build signing key after the old one hit its expiry window — nothing dramatic, just routine hygiene. Scaling logic for fractional yields is unchanged, but the metric/imperial converter got a small precision fix. If you're setting up your local release tooling this week, you'll need the fresh key before anything will sign. The new deploy key for this cycle is:

signing key of yajop-hahog = bky4_eXoX

Handover note — Crumbwheel order cutoffs.

Welcome aboard. The bakery cutoff rule in Crumbwheel closes same-day orders at 14:00 local to each storefront, not UTC — this has bitten us twice. Holiday overrides live in the calendar service and take precedence silently, so always check there first when a cutoff looks wrong. To unlock the calendar service's admin console after a restart, enter the recovery passphrase below.

vault phrase of bagap-bahaf = silion-pelox-sorox-casdor-quenwyn-fraax-eliox-praael-kelion-quenvan-kasox-rusael-norius-belvan

If the Fairfare parity checker reports sustained discrepancies — the same room priced differently across our Lodgeline channels for more than four hours — do not silence the alert. First, confirm the scraper snapshots in the Parity dashboard are fresh; stale snapshots cause most false positives. If snapshots are current and the discrepancy exceeds 3%, page the pricing on-call and file a severity-2 ticket. For partner-facing pricing disputes, escalate directly to the parity team at the address below.

pager mailbox: silael.sorwyn.tamius@zemvarsys.corp